Google Cloud – Powering Possibilities:
Think of Google Cloud as a digital powerhouse that offers a range of services. It’s like a supercharged toolbox for businesses, providing storage, computing power, and a host of other tools—all in the cloud. This means companies can store data, run applications, and collaborate, all with the reliability and scale of Google’s infrastructure.
Key Features and Benefits:
1. Scalability: Google Cloud grows with your company. Whether you’re a small startup or a large enterprise, you can scale up or down as needed, ensuring you’re not paying for more than you use.
2. Reliability: Trust is crucial in business, and Google Cloud delivers on reliability. Your data is stored securely, and services are designed to be available when you need them, minimizing downtime.
3. Security: Protecting sensitive information is a top priority. Google Cloud employs robust security measures, including encryption and identity management, to keep your data safe.
4. AI and Machine Learning: Google Cloud brings the power of AI and machine learning to your fingertips. Companies can leverage these technologies to gain insights, automate tasks, and make more informed decisions.

Key Applications and Benefits:
1. Gmail: Email is at the heart of communication. With Gmail, companies get a powerful, easy-to-use platform that includes features like advanced search and organized inboxes.
2. Google Drive: Say goodbye to lost files. Google Drive allows teams to store, access, and share documents in the cloud, promoting collaboration and eliminating version control issues.
3. Google Docs, Sheets, and Slides: The trio that transforms the way we create and edit documents, spreadsheets, and presentations. 4. Google Meet: In the era of remote work, video meetings are essential. Google Meet makes virtual collaboration a breeze with features like screen sharing and chat.
5. Calendar and Forms: Stay organized with Calendar, and gather information effortlessly with Forms. These tools enhance efficiency and simplify tasks.
